Patents by Inventor Mike Roberts

Mike Roberts has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8406818
    Abstract: Embodiments of the disclosed invention include an apparatus, method, and computer program product for providing a larger display area for viewing pictures and/or videos on a communication device. For example, in one embodiment, a communication device is disclosed comprising a plurality of display components for displaying an image that covers a plurality of sides of the communication device. In certain embodiments, a user first image is displayed in response to receiving an incoming call for providing a visible indicator for alerting the user of an incoming call.
    Type: Grant
    Filed: July 23, 2012
    Date of Patent: March 26, 2013
    Assignee: CenturyLink Intellectual Property LLC
    Inventors: Mike Roberts, Shekhar Gupta, Krishna Kolothuparambil Bhaskarankutty Nair
  • Publication number: 20120288073
    Abstract: Embodiments of the disclosed invention include an apparatus, method, and computer program product for providing a larger display area for viewing pictures and/or videos on a communication device. For example, in one embodiment, a communication device is disclosed comprising a plurality of display components for displaying an image that covers a plurality of sides of the communication device. In certain embodiments, a user first image is displayed in response to receiving an incoming call for providing a visible indicator for alerting the user of an incoming call.
    Type: Application
    Filed: July 23, 2012
    Publication date: November 15, 2012
    Inventors: Mike Roberts, Shekhar Gupta, Krishna Kolothuparambil Bhaskarankutty Nair
  • Patent number: 8260363
    Abstract: Embodiments of the disclosed invention include an apparatus, method, and computer program product for providing a larger display area for viewing pictures and/or videos on a communication device. For example, in one embodiment, a communication device is disclosed comprising a plurality of display components for displaying an image that covers a plurality of sides of the communication device. In certain embodiments, a user specified image is displayed in response to receiving an incoming call for providing a more visible indicator for alerting the user of an incoming call.
    Type: Grant
    Filed: June 25, 2009
    Date of Patent: September 4, 2012
    Assignee: Embarq Holdings Company, LLC
    Inventors: Mike Roberts, Shekhar Gupta, Krishna Kolothuparambil Bhaskarankutty Nair
  • Publication number: 20110299745
    Abstract: A parallelized sparse field method for segmenting a volume dataset is provided. Using a processor a level set field within a multi-dimensional dataset comprising a plurality of voxels is initialized in parallel operation. The multi-dimensional dataset is indicative of an object. An initial set of active voxels is then generated in parallel operation in dependence upon the initialized level set field. New active voxels are determined in parallel operation. Duplicate active voxels are then removed in parallel operation, followed by compacting the active voxels in parallel operation. The process is repeated until a quantitative stopping criterion is met and level set segmentation data indicative of a feature of the object are determined in dependence upon the level set field.
    Type: Application
    Filed: June 6, 2011
    Publication date: December 8, 2011
    Applicant: Calgary Scientific Inc.
    Inventors: Mike Roberts, Mario Costa Sousa, Joseph Ross Mitchell
  • Publication number: 20110074780
    Abstract: A method for segmenting a volume dataset is provided. During initialization a level set field within a volume dataset is initialized and an initial set of active voxels is determined in dependence upon the initialized level set field. In an iteration process the level set field for the set of active voxels is updated followed by updating of the set of active voxels. The iteration is continued until the number of active voxels is less than a predetermined threshold. Level set segmentation data are then determined in dependence upon the level set field and provided for, for example, graphical display or storage.
    Type: Application
    Filed: September 24, 2010
    Publication date: March 31, 2011
    Applicant: Calgary Scientific Inc.
    Inventors: Mike Roberts, Mario Costa Sousa, Joseph Ross Mitchell
  • Publication number: 20100331054
    Abstract: Embodiments of the disclosed invention include an apparatus, method, and computer program product for providing a larger display area for viewing pictures and/or videos on a communication device. For example, in one embodiment, a communication device is disclosed comprising a plurality of display components for displaying an image that covers a plurality of sides of the communication device. In certain embodiments, a user specified image is displayed in response to receiving an incoming call for providing a more visible indicator for alerting the user of an incoming call.
    Type: Application
    Filed: June 25, 2009
    Publication date: December 30, 2010
    Inventors: Mike Roberts, Shekhar Gupta, Krishna Kolothuparambil Bhaskarankutty Nair
  • Publication number: 20100098226
    Abstract: A system and method for managing messages, such as, but not limited to, voicemails and text messages, is presented. For example, in one embodiment, the method includes identifying a caller associated with a message for a callee. The method determines whether at least one other new message for the callee is from the caller. In response to at least one other new message for the callee is from the caller, the method groups the message with the at least one other new message.
    Type: Application
    Filed: October 22, 2008
    Publication date: April 22, 2010
    Inventors: Shekhar Gupta, Mike Roberts, Blaine Smith
  • Publication number: 20100091465
    Abstract: The disclosed embodiments provide an apparatus and method for improving customer retention. In accordance with one embodiment, a telecommunication device comprising a chassis that includes features for operating the telecommunication device and a display module removably coupled to the chassis is presented. The chassis is compatible with different display modules. Thus, the disclosed embodiments enable a telecom customer to upgrade a telecommunication device at minimal cost, thereby, improving customer retention.
    Type: Application
    Filed: October 13, 2008
    Publication date: April 15, 2010
    Inventors: Mike Roberts, Jeffrey Stafford, Tony Dandridge
  • Patent number: 6684119
    Abstract: A method of providing dynamic production material replenishment information via an internet includes the steps of tracking real-time usage of material used for a product, maintaining the tracked real-time material usage within a computer database on a local computer network and replicating the tracked real-time material usage on a global business network in communication with the local communication network. The method also includes the steps of providing a user internet access to a material usage information web site, identifying if a user has permission to access the material usage information web site and selecting a predetermined attribute of the tracked real-time material usage by the user. The method further includes the steps of providing the tracked real-time material usage on the material usage information web site based on the selected attributes and using the tracked real-time material usage by the user in replenishing the material.
    Type: Grant
    Filed: February 3, 2001
    Date of Patent: January 27, 2004
    Assignee: Ford Motor Company
    Inventors: Mike Robert Burnard, Lawton Chen, Richard Thomas DeMuro
  • Publication number: 20020107601
    Abstract: A method of providing dynamic production material replenishment information via an internet includes the steps of tracking real-time usage of material used for a product, maintaining the tracked real-time material usage within a computer database on a local computer network and replicating the tracked real-time material usage on a global business network in communication with the local communication network. The method also includes the steps of providing a user internet access to a material usage information web site, identifying if a user has permission to access the material usage information web site and selecting a predetermined attribute of the tracked real-time material usage by the user. The method further includes the steps of providing the tracked real-time material usage on the material usage information web site based on the selected attributes and using the tracked real-time material usage by the user in replenishing the material.
    Type: Application
    Filed: February 3, 2001
    Publication date: August 8, 2002
    Inventors: Mike Robert Burnard, Lawton Chen, Richard Thomas DeMuro